The Rise of Free Movie Websites
With the skyrocketing costs of cable subscriptions and online movie rentals, it's no surprise that free movie websites have become more popular than ever. These sites boast access to the latest movies and TV shows without the need for a subscription or rental fee. However, it's important to delve deeper into the underbelly of these sites to understand the true cost of using them.
The Legality of Free Movie Websites
While some free movie websites claim to be legal, the reality is that many of them operate in a gray area of copyright law. Streaming movies without permission from the copyright holder is illegal, and many of these sites are shut down as a result. In addition, users can face fines or legal consequences for using them.
The Risks of Using Free Movie Websites
In addition to the legality issue, there are many risks associated with using free movie websites. These sites often contain malware or viruses that can harm your device or steal your personal information. They may also include pop-up ads that lead to even more dangerous or inappropriate content. In short, using these sites puts both your device and your personal safety at risk.
Quality of Content
Perhaps the most obvious downside to using free movie websites is the quality of the content. These sites often stream low-quality versions of movies and TV shows that are easily detected by viewers. Additionally, some movies may not even be available in full, with scenes or entire portions of the story missing. For those looking for a quality viewing experience, these sites fall far short.
Selection of Content
While free movie websites may offer access to the latest blockbusters, their selection is often limited when compared to paid streaming services. Many independent or foreign films, documentaries, or older releases may not be available on these sites. In addition, the quality or availability of specific titles can vary widely between different sites. For those looking for a specific or varied selection of content, paying for a subscription service may be the better option.
User Experience
Free movie websites are often plagued by poor user experiences, with slow loading times, broken links, or incorrect or incomplete descriptions of the content. In addition, the constant barrage of pop-up ads or clickbait can make it difficult to navigate the site or find the desired content. Paid streaming services may offer a smoother and more intuitive user interface, with better search tools and recommendations based on past viewing habits.
Cost
While free movie websites may appear to offer a cost-effective alternative to paid streaming services, the reality is that there are hidden costs associated with using them. These costs may include malware removal, lost data or identity theft, or legal fees if caught using illegal streaming sites. Additionally, the time and effort spent searching for quality content on free sites may end up costing more than the subscription fees of paid services in the long run.
Reliability and Availability
Free movie websites are often unreliable and temporary, with frequent closures or shutdowns due to legal action or technical issues. This can be frustrating for users who have come to rely on certain sites for their viewing needs, only to have them disappear overnight. Additionally, many of these sites may not be available in all regions, limiting access for international or remote viewers. Paid streaming services provide a more reliable and consistent viewing experience, with guaranteed access to a wide variety of content.
Ethical Considerations
Finally, it's important to consider the ethics of using free movie websites. While it may seem harmless to watch the latest blockbuster for free, the reality is that these illegal streaming sites contribute to lost revenue for the entertainment industry and prevent artists from being fairly compensated for their work. By paying for a subscription service or renting movies through legitimate channels, consumers can support the industry and promote the creation of new content.

Free movie websites are online platforms that allow users to watch movies for free without paying any subscription fees or rental fees. However, these websites do not have the legal rights to distribute or stream movies, making them illegal and potentially dangerous for users.
Free movie websites are illegal because they violate copyright laws by distributing or streaming movies without the permission of the owners. This practice deprives movie studios and filmmakers of their rightful earnings and damages the industry as a whole.
No, free movie websites are not safe. They often contain malware, viruses, and other harmful content that can damage your device and compromise your personal information. Additionally, the websites may expose you to legal risks and penalties for engaging in illegal activities.
The risks of using free movie websites include exposure to malware and viruses, legal penalties for violating copyright laws, and potential damage to your device and personal information. Additionally, these websites may not offer high-quality or reliable streams, leading to a poor viewing experience.
You can watch movies legally by subscribing to legitimate streaming services like Netflix, Hulu, Amazon Prime Video, or Disney+. You can also rent or purchase movies from reputable sources like iTunes, Google Play, or Vudu.
